Active Recombinant Cynomolgus IL11 protein, His-tagged
Cat.No. : | IL11-1580C |
Product Overview : | Recombinant Cynomolgus IL11 protein(Pro22-Leu199), fused with His tag, was expressed in HEK293. |

Source : | HEK293 |
Species : | Cynomolgus |
Tag : | His |
Form : | Lyophilized from 0.22 μm filtered solution in PBS, pH7.4 with trehalose as protectant. |
Bio-activity : | Immobilized Cynomolgus IL-11 Protein, His Tag at 5 μg/mL (100 μL/well) can bind Human IL-11 R alpha, Fc Tag with a linear range of 0.02-0.625 μg/mL. |
Molecular Mass : | This protein carries a polyhistidine tag at the N-terminusThe protein has a calculated MW of 21 kDa. The protein migrates as 22-26 kDa under reducing (R) condition (SDS-PAGE) due to glycosylation. |
Proteinlength : | Pro22-Leu199 |
Endotoxin : | Less than 1.0 EU per μg by the LAL method. |
Purity : | >90% as determined by SDS-PAGE. |
Storage : | For long term, the product should be stored at lyophilized state at -20°C or lower.Please avoid repeated freeze-thaw cycles. This product is stable after at: -20°C to -70°C for 12 months in lyophilized state; -70°C for 3 months under sterile conditions after reconstitution. |
Reconstitution : | It is recommended that sterile water be added to the vial to prepare a stock solution of 0.2 ug/ul. Centrifuge the vial at 4°C before opening to recover the entire contents. |
